In a landmark diplomatic engagement on Wednesday, Chinese President Xi Jinping met with Colombian President Gustavo Petro in Beijing. The visit underscores Beijing’s expanding ties with Latin America, reflecting a world increasingly shaped by South-South cooperation.

For young global citizens, the meeting offers a real-time example of how nimble diplomacy can open doors for trade, technology exchange, and cultural partnerships. While official statements are pending, analysts anticipate talks around sustainable development, digital innovation, and boosting bilateral trade links.
